Wireless speakers work by transmitting audio signals through the air rather than using physical cables. Your PC can connect to speakers through several different technologies, each with its own strengths and limitations. This guide explores the main wireless methods available to turn your current PC speakers into a wireless setup without spending money on new equipment.

The most common wireless technologies for PC speakers include Bluetooth, Wi-Fi Direct, and radio frequency (RF) connections. Bluetooth is the most widespread option because nearly every modern computer includes built-in Bluetooth capability. Wi-Fi Direct allows devices to communicate over your existing internet connection or create their own network. Radio frequency systems require a USB transmitter but often provide longer range and more reliable connections in homes with many wireless devices.
Before starting any conversion process, you should identify what type of speakers you currently own. Desktop PC speakers typically come in a few varieties: powered speakers with built-in amplifiers, passive speakers that require an external amplifier, or older speaker systems connected through analog cables. Each type has different considerations for wireless conversion. Powered speakers are generally easier to convert because they already contain the necessary electronics. Passive speakers require more complex modifications and may not be practical for wireless conversion without professional help.
Understanding your current speaker setup also means checking the connectivity ports on your speakers. Most modern powered desktop speakers connect via 3.5mm audio jack (headphone-sized), USB, or RCA connectors. Some gaming or higher-end speakers may have multiple input options. Knowing these details helps you understand which wireless methods will work with your equipment and what additional components, if any, you might need to obtain.
Practical Takeaway: Examine your speakers for model information and connection types. Check your PC's system settings to confirm whether it has Bluetooth capability. This basic inventory determines which wireless methods are actually possible for your setup.
Bluetooth is often the most straightforward wireless option because most modern computers already have Bluetooth built in. This method works by pairing your PC with a Bluetooth receiver that connects to your speakers. If your speakers have integrated Bluetooth, you can pair them directly with your PC. If not, you can add Bluetooth capability through a small receiver device that costs between $15 and $40.

To determine if your PC has Bluetooth, go to Settings on Windows or System Preferences on Mac, then look for Bluetooth options. If you see Bluetooth listed and it shows "On" or "Available," your computer has this capability. For Linux users, check your system settings under Wireless or Network options. If your PC doesn't have built-in Bluetooth, you can purchase a USB Bluetooth adapter that plugs into any available USB port. These adapters are small dongles about the size of a thumb drive and contain all the necessary wireless hardware.
The actual pairing process is relatively consistent across all devices. First, turn on your Bluetooth receiver or speakers and put them in pairing mode (usually by holding a button for several seconds until a light flashes). On your PC, open Bluetooth settings and select "Add a new device" or "Pair a new device." Your PC will scan for nearby Bluetooth devices and display a list. Select your speaker from the list and confirm the pairing. Once paired, your speaker will appear as a connected audio output device in your sound settings.
One important consideration with Bluetooth is range and interference. Bluetooth typically works within 30 feet of your PC, though walls and other obstacles can reduce this range. Interference from other wireless devices like Wi-Fi routers, microwaves, and wireless mice can occasionally cause audio dropouts or connection issues. Bluetooth 5.0 technology offers better range and reliability than older versions, so checking your device specifications may reveal what Bluetooth version you're using. If you experience connection problems, moving your PC and speaker closer together or repositioning your Wi-Fi router may improve performance.
Practical Takeaway: Check your PC's Bluetooth status in system settings. If available, pair your speakers by putting them in pairing mode and selecting them from your PC's Bluetooth device list. If Bluetooth isn't built in, a USB Bluetooth adapter is an affordable addition that provides the same functionality.
Wi-Fi offers an alternative wireless method that uses your home network to transmit audio from your PC to your speakers. This approach works well in homes where Bluetooth range or interference is problematic, and it often provides more reliable connection stability. Wi-Fi audio transmission requires different software or hardware than Bluetooth, but several approaches exist for turning existing speakers wireless using your network.

One method involves using Wi-Fi streaming software that turns your PC into a media server. Software like AirAudio, Pulseaudio, or open-source solutions such as PulseAudio with Network Support can stream audio over your home network to compatible receiving devices. Many of these solutions require configuration through your PC's settings or command line, though some provide graphical interfaces that are more user-friendly. The receiving end typically needs a small device called a Wi-Fi receiver or a smart speaker that can connect to your network and output audio through your speakers.
If your speakers have Wi-Fi capability built in, setup becomes much simpler. Some modern powered speakers include Wi-Fi connectivity and compatible apps. You would install the speaker manufacturer's app on your PC, connect both devices to your home Wi-Fi network, and select the speaker as your audio output. This method avoids needing any additional hardware and uses your existing speakers as-is.
For speakers without built-in Wi-Fi, you can use a device like a Raspberry Pi (a small single-board computer) or even repurpose an old computer as a Wi-Fi audio receiver. These devices can run software like Shairport or Snapserver that receives audio from your PC over Wi-Fi and outputs it to your speakers through a standard audio cable. This approach is more technical than Bluetooth solutions but provides excellent reliability and range throughout your home. The initial setup requires some familiarity with networking and possibly Linux-based systems, but once configured, the system typically works without further intervention.
Practical Takeaway: Assess whether your speakers have built-in Wi-Fi capability by checking the manufacturer's specifications. If they do, use the manufacturer's app to connect. If not, research whether a Wi-Fi receiver device or software solution suits your technical comfort level and budget.
Radio frequency (RF) wireless systems represent another wireless option that doesn't rely on Bluetooth or Wi-Fi. RF systems use a USB transmitter plugged into your PC that sends audio signals to an RF receiver connected to your speakers. This technology was particularly common in wireless speaker systems sold 10-15 years ago, though it's less prevalent in newer products. If you own an older wireless speaker system that you want to continue using, understanding RF setup helps explain how these connections work.

RF wireless systems operate on specific frequencies, often in the 2.4 GHz band (the same frequency as Wi-Fi and Bluetooth, though using different technology). Some RF systems use proprietary frequencies for reduced interference. The main advantage of RF over Bluetooth is typically better range, sometimes extending 100 feet or more, making it suitable for larger homes or outdoor use. RF systems are also less susceptible to interference from other wireless devices in many cases, though devices on the same frequency can still cause issues.
Setting up an RF system begins with plugging the USB transmitter into your PC. Your computer should automatically recognize the device, though you may need to install drivers from the manufacturer's website. Once installed, the RF receiver connects to your speakers' audio input. You'll typically see the receiver as a new audio output option in your PC's sound settings. Select it, and audio will transmit wirelessly to your speakers. Most RF systems don't require pairing like Bluetooth does; they automatically connect when powered on, as long as both devices are set to the same frequency or channel.
One consideration with RF systems is that older hardware may not be compatible with modern computers, particularly if drivers are no longer available from the manufacturer. Some older RF speaker systems relied on Windows XP or Vista drivers that don't work with current operating systems. Before investing effort in setting up an older RF system, check the manufacturer's website for current driver support. If drivers aren't available, the system likely won't function with your modern PC.
